As used in this subchapter, unless the context otherwise requires:
(1)"Commission" means the Arkansas Livestock and Poultry Commission created by § 2-33-101 ;
(2)"Large animal" means cattle, horses, hogs, sheep, goats, cervidae, bison, llamas, alpacas, ostriches, emus, rheas, and other native or nonnative animals, excluding dogs and cats; and (3) "Large animal carcasses" means carcasses of large animals which died as the result of sickness, suffocation, accident, or from any cause other than intentional slaughter.
